The JXYY2K drum kit has become a staple for music producers aiming to recreate the distinct sonic landscape of the early 2000s. Named after the "Year 2000" aesthetic, this kit blends retro digital textures with high-energy modern trap and electronic elements. A defining feature of PluggnB is its reliance on classic VST sounds like SonicXTC or Luxonix Purity. The kit provides custom wav-format one-shots of signature bells, Rhodes, pads, and leads, making it incredibly lightweight and CPU-friendly.
